I have had the brake recall and front vents done about 6 months ago. This cured both the brake squeal most people get and brake judder
But after a track day the judder came back. Dealer took one look at the disks and pads and said there was no way that Audi would replace them as it had been tracked.
I then had the front disks skimmed and some brembo pads fitted which did sort the brake judder out.
But after just a few minutes of light braking on another track day , the judder came back. It gets worse with harder braking but is always there even under light normal braking on the road
So. My thoughts were to junk the stock disks and get upgraded ones that work with stock callipers. Any thoughts on this approach and the make to go for?
I'm pretty sure it's the front disks as applying the handbrake doesn't make it happen and the tremor is felt through steering wheel. Would my diagnosis be correct?
